Signs Your AC Needs Maintenance
A few signs it’s time to schedule a tune-up:
- It’s been over a year since your last professional inspection
- Your energy bills are creeping up without a change in usage
- Weak airflow or uneven cooling between rooms
- Unusual noises, odors, or your system cycling on and off more than usual
- Your system is under warranty and requires proof of regular maintenance
Our AC Maintenance Process
Every maintenance visit follows the same thorough checklist:
- Inspect and clean coils, filters, and condensate drains
- Check refrigerant levels and look for signs of leaks
- Test electrical connections, capacitors, and the thermostat
- Verify proper airflow and system cycling
- Flag any parts showing early wear before they fail

FAQ
How often should I schedule AC maintenance?
Most manufacturers and technicians recommend once a year, ideally in spring before cooling season ramps up.
What’s included in an AC tune-up?
A full inspection of coils, filters, refrigerant levels, electrical components, and airflow — plus a report on anything that needs attention.
Does maintenance really prevent breakdowns?
Yes. Most AC failures we see start as small issues, like a dirty coil or low refrigerant, that go unnoticed without regular checks.
Will maintenance void my warranty if I skip it?
Many manufacturers require proof of regular maintenance to keep warranties valid, so skipping it can cost you more later.
